With the New York Yankees desperately needing to break out of a nine-game losing streak, their 2022 MVP, Aaron Judge, put the team on his back with a career night in the Bronx on Wednesday. Judge hit three home runs in a single game for the first time in his career, as the Yankees defeated the Washington Nationals, 9-1. Judge was responsible for six of those runs. The Yankees hadn’t lost this many games in a row since 1982, and after GM Brian Cashman described the season as a “disaster” prior to first pitch, the vibes certainly weren’t high at Yankee Stadium. They were dead last in the Al East with a 60-65 entering Wednesday. Aaron Judge #99 of the New York Yankees hits a grand slam
